## Break-Glass: Queue Migration (Trellix→Corvidq)

Security context: we are replacing the homegrown Trellix job queue with Corvidq. During cutover, dual-write is enabled and both brokers accept jobs. Break-glass access to the legacy Trellix admin shell is restricted to the migration window and logged to the Hallow audit stream. Reviewers should confirm that all emergency sessions auto-expire at 15 minutes and that queue credentials rotate post-incident. Access to the legacy shell during the window requires the recovery passphrase below.

vault phrase of bagaf-kajeg = jorath-feniel-briir-siliel-ralix

Ticket VX-2291: The Lunaform localization bundle for date formats (dd.MM.yyyy variants for the Karvenia rollout) failed its signature check during the nightly verify pass. The bundle was rebuilt after the locale data refresh, but the manifest was signed with the retired 2023 key. Pipeline now blocks promotion. We re-signed with the current release key and verification passes locally. For audit purposes, the key used for the re-sign is recorded below.

signing key of hahag-tahag = bky4_v18e

HANDOVER — Commission Scheme Revision

To the incoming director: the revised scheme goes live on the 1st. Key changes: accelerators start at 110% of quota, not 100%; multi-year Quillstone deals pay out over term, not upfront; clawbacks extend to nine months. Reps were briefed last week — expect pushback from the Ashgrove pod. Payroll mapping is done; Tomas owns the calculator. Disputes route through RevOps, not you. One outstanding item: the enterprise override rate is unresolved. Background for that decision sits below.

internal memo for kahif-kawig: Project Fravan slips by two quarters because of the tooling delay.

Ticket: Config drift — GridWeave spreadsheet export memory

Priority: High

The GridWeave export workers in production have drifted from the values in the release manifest, which explains the elevated memory usage during large spreadsheet exports. Staging still matches the manifest and shows no regression. Before cutting the next release, please reconcile against the following currently-deployed production configuration:

deployment values, kajep-kageg:
[praix]
host = praix.paliqcorp.corp
user = praix_svc
database = praix_prod